Improving your sniper skills - resource post (Warning: LOTS of text)

I made this post in another thread, and thought the information listed may be useful for others who also wanted to improve their sniping and general PvP skills. So without further adieu, here it is. I'm not a pro, and I don't snipe as often as I used to these days in PvP, however, I do have some tips that may help. Brace yourself, this is going to be a [b]LONG[/b] post. You've been warned. There are two facets that make a good sniper (Or just a better player in general), in order of importance. [b]- Positioning/Game skill - Gun Skill[/b] As it is with most things regarding Destiny PvP, to effectively fight enemy players, it's all about location, location, location. Positioning is key, and requires you to understand where the common "sniper" lanes are on a map. Even semi experienced players will know some of the more common/obvious areas where snipers like to take up perch (A good example is the ruined building close to B flag special ammo spawn on Widows court. From this spot, you can head glitch and have a decent LoS to A flag's heavy spawn) You want to limit how many angles the enemy has on you, and force them into a "cone" out in front of you if at all possible, effectively creating a "beaten zone" or "kill zone" where the enemy must challenge you while entering your scopes field of view, and only that field of view. How you maneuver around the map is extremely important for you to improve both as a sniper and just overall as a player in PvP. Players with higher "gun skill" can push aggressively with a sniper rifle, and still come out on top, since they have the "mechanical" skills to do so (ie. Quickly scope in CQC, and land a head shot). Nothing we advise can help you develop your gun skill in a meaningful way per say, however, there are things that you CAN practice doing on your own. The first I recommend is learning how to "pre-aim". What do I mean by this? Pre-aiming is when you visually center your target on your screen, or as close as you can, before you Aim Down Sights (ADS). This reduces the time it takes for you to acquire, line up your reticule and take the shot. [b]Coolguy[/b] covers this very topic in a video of his, which you may watch, here. [spoiler]https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=LQ78viT0c8U[/spoiler] To get acquainted with this, I recommend going to Venus. Once you spawn in, head directly left from the spawn to the "Ember Caves". Try to practice landing only head shots while scoping in on the Fallen here. The Fallen vandals especially, are roughly the same height as a Guardian, and both the Dregs and Vandals heads are about the same size as a guardians as well. I like this area since it offers a wide variety of different sight lines, and the mobs spawn relatively quickly with minimal movement between "pod" to "pod" of enemy mobs, making grabbing extra special ammo between them easier. Once you have the idea of HOW to "Pre-aim", the only way you can reliably do this is to just practice it in the Crucible.[b] I repeat; no amount of PvE practice will ever truly prepare you for the chaos that comes while playing real players. Only repeated failures and practice will make you better at doing this (Like just about anything in life, hard work, dedication and knowing what you did right/wrong is the only way to improve in any meaningful way.[/b] It has taken me countless hours of playing, analyzing and playing some more to get where I'm at now. Even so, I'm just average at best. [u][b]Weapons[/b][/u] As far as weapons are concerned, the current meta favors Sniper rifles that fall within the 31 Impact 19 ROF. This includes the infamous 1000-Yard Stare, LDR 5001, Y-09 Lonbow Synthesis and to a lesser extent, the Eirene RR4 Why these specific rifles? They all strike a good balance between Rate of fire, impact, and aim assist. (The exception going towards the Eirine RR4, which has the lowest base aim assist between the 4 rifles of 21, as opposed to AA values of 56 (1k stare), 64 (LDR 5001) and 68 (Y-09 Longbow Synthesis) respectively) Further more, if you get into game modes that have the option to revive players, you can perform the infamous "res snipe", since their impact values are high enough to do this. (The minimum impact required to res snipe is 16) This does [b][u]NOT[/u][/b] mean the lower Impact varieties such as Weylorn's march & the Uzume RR4 (Both of which fall under the lowest Impact archetype of Sniper rifles with a rating of 13) are bad weapons, but for the sake of consistency and reliability between both PvE & PvP, the rifles listed are by far the most sought after archetype you could go for. [b]***NOTE***[/b] Something to note about Weylorn's March. Out of ALL the Sniper rifles available, this Iron Banner exclusive sniper rifle comes with the HIGHEST base Aim Assist value of ALL legendary sniper rifles (Higher than even the exotic sniper rifle Hereafter, which has an AA value of 75 or the Y-09 Longbow Synthesis) with an AA value of 79. This means, that if you so desired, you can have more flexibility for other perks that boost this weapons utility in other areas such as having Outlaw, Firefly or Mulligan if you so desired. Ultimately, [u][b]PICK WHICHEVER RIFLE/ARCHETYPE THAT WORKS FOR YOU![/b][/u].
